Winter Festivities in Prague's Old Town Square

Winter ‍Festivities in Prague’s Old Town Square

For those ⁣visiting Prague in ​December, the Old Town ​Square transforms into a magical winter wonderland filled with festive activities ‌and attractions. ⁢The ⁢charming cobblestone square ⁣is ‍adorned with twinkling lights, a towering Christmas tree, ⁤and traditional wooden stalls ​selling⁤ handmade gifts and seasonal‌ treats.

Visitors can warm up with ‍a cup ‍of hot​ mulled wine⁢ or try traditional Czech ‌delicacies such as trdelník, a sweet ​pastry cooked over an ‍open ⁢flame. The ‌square also hosts live music performances, ‌cultural ​events, and a bustling Christmas market where ⁢you ‍can find unique ​souvenirs to take home. ⁣Don’t miss the ⁤opportunity to⁣ ice skate on the outdoor⁢ rink surrounded‍ by historic buildings and the iconic Astronomical Clock.

Warm Up at Traditional​ Czech Beer Halls

Warm⁢ Up at Traditional ‍Czech Beer‍ Halls

In December, Prague transforms into a magical winter wonderland, with charming⁣ Christmas markets and a festive atmosphere. One of the ⁣best ⁣ways to embrace ⁤the holiday​ spirit is by warming up⁣ at traditional⁤ Czech⁢ beer ‍halls scattered ⁤throughout the city.​ These ⁢cozy establishments⁣ offer a‌ respite from ‍the chilly weather outside, ​inviting⁤ visitors to relax, socialize, and⁤ enjoy⁤ the ‌local brews.

Step inside ​one of these‍ beer halls, adorned with‍ intricate woodwork and vintage​ decor, and you’ll be transported⁤ back ‍in time to a​ bygone‍ era. Sip⁢ on​ a pint of rich, malty Czech beer, ‌such as Pilsner Urquell or ‍Budvar, and savor​ the flavors of this beloved Czech tradition. Pair your drink with hearty Czech ⁢dishes‌ like goulash, roasted pork knuckle, or fried cheese, and indulge in a true ⁢taste⁣ of ‌the local cuisine. With live⁣ music, jovial crowds, and a festive ambiance,⁢ a visit to⁤ a traditional⁤ Czech ⁤beer ‍hall is an essential experience for any traveler exploring⁤ Prague in ‍December.

Indulging in Czech​ Christmas Treats

Indulging ⁢in Czech Christmas ⁢Treats

Prague is ​the perfect destination‌ for those⁤ looking to indulge in Czech Christmas treats during ‌the ⁢winter season.⁢ The​ city transforms into⁣ a⁢ magical winter wonderland with charming Christmas markets scattered⁢ throughout the historic streets. One ⁢of the highlights of visiting Prague in December ⁣is sampling the delicious traditional treats that are synonymous⁤ with‌ Czech Christmas celebrations.

From indulgent gingerbread cookies and fragrant mulled wine to savory roasted sausages⁤ and hearty potato pancakes, there is no shortage ‌of delectable delights to ⁤tempt your taste ⁣buds. Make sure to try ‌the iconic⁣ trdelník, a sweet pastry‌ cooked‍ on a ⁤rotating spit over an open flame and dusted‍ with cinnamon sugar.
